Flying Ants

"Just like the wingless red ants, the flying red ants can deliver a very potent sting...Flying red ants should always be avoided since they will use their jaws to get a stable grip and then inject toxic alkaloid venom from the abdomen." Copyright 2006 flyingant.info

This was an unplanned, hand held, very nervously taken, quick shot as these winged things were unexpectely flying all around me. Geesh! It's a good thing that I didn't know about their nasty bite at the time. Their looks creeped me out enough.
